Florence is the capital city of Tuscany Region. Florence is regarded as one of the most beautiful cities in the world. The historic centre of this city attracts millions of tourists each year. Pisa is best known over the world for its Leaning Tower and also contains more than 20 other historic churches, several palaces and various bridges across the River Arno.

Upon arrival at Pisa, your first visit will be at the Cathedral complex in the magnificent "Piazza dei Miracoli", the large square home of Leaning Tower, the Baptistery and the beautiful Cathedral. You will see with your eyes the incredible Tower that was designed for being the bell tower of the close by Cathedral and that would stand 185 feet high. There is a 297 step spiral staircase inside the tower leading to the top. Your first visit upon arriving in Florence will be at Piazzale Michelangelo terrace, which portrays the glorious panorama of the city. Once in the old-town pedestrian center, probably the first wonder you will encounter will be the immense Cathedral of S. Maria del Fiore. This Cathedral is one the major center of attraction for tourists and one of the largest churches in Italy, and until the modern era, the dome was the largest in the world. It remains the largest brick dome ever constructed, thanks to the genius of Brunelleschi who completed it in 1432. See Giotto's Bell Tower, the Baptistery and the Piazza della Signoria. After giving a look at the scenic and iconic Ponte Vecchio (Old Bridge) on the Arno river, continue to the enormous Piazza Santa Croce. In the Roman times, this place was used to execute heretics, the square now boasts numerous charming boutiques other than being home of a marvelous Basilica.
The Galleria dell'Academia is one of the top museums in Florence mainly because it is the home to Michelangelo's David sculpture. The statue of David, which was moved in this museum in 1873, ranks amongst the top masterpieces of the Italian Art.
